Learned counsel for the petitioners submits that one of the arguments of the petitioners was based on the judgment of Supreme Court in Ram Naresh

Rawat. Recently the judgment of Ram Naresh Rawat is referred to a Larger Bench and awaiting the said decision, the matter may be adjourned.

The prayer is allowed.

The matters are adjourned sine die with the liberty to mention the matters after the decision of the Larger Bench.
